The Kawasaki KLR 250 was produced from 1997-00 and features a four-stroke, single cylinder DOHC engine with a capacity of 249cc. It has a liquid-cooled system and a compression ratio of 11.0:1. The bike uses a Keihin CVK34 carburetor and CDI ignition, starting with a kick. It has a maximum power of 30 horsepower at 8500 RPM and a maximum torque of 2.6 kgf-m at 7500 RPM. The transmission is six-speed with a final drive chain. The KLR 250 has a front air-adjustable leading-axle fork, and the Uni-Trak single shock rear suspension with adjustable preload and 4-way rebound damping. The front brake has a single 250mm disc with a 2 piston caliper, and the rear brake is a drum. The bike has a seat height of 856mm and a dry weight of 117kg.
